A farewell ceremony was held at the Indian High Commission to mark the end of the tenure of Indian High Commissioner in Sri Lanka, Tharanjith Sin Sandhu.
TharanjithSinh Sandhu served as the Indian High Commissioner in Sri Lanka for about three years. President Gotabhaya Rajapaksa who participated in the farewell ceremony commended TharanjithSinh Sandhu’s service in the island nation. Prime Minister Mahinda Rajapaksa also congratulated him. Opposition Leader Sajith Premadasa and a large number of political representatives were present at the occasion.
